What is hsa payroll deduction form
The HSA Payroll Deduction Form is a payroll document used by employees to elect an annual contribution amount for their Health Savings Account (HSA).

Key Features of the HSA Payroll Deduction Form
The HSA Payroll Deduction Form is designed with several critical features. It encompasses fillable fields that require essential information such as the employee’s name, address, social security number (SSN), and chosen contribution amount. Employees can reference a table included in the form, illustrating examples of contributions based on various annual amounts.
A disclaimer regarding HSAs clarifies contribution limits and responsibilities, making it clear for users to understand the full scope of their contributions.

Who is eligible to use the HSA Payroll Deduction Form?
Employees of companies that offer Health Savings Accounts (HSAs) are eligible to use this form to elect their contribution amounts.
When should I submit the HSA Payroll Deduction Form?
It's best to submit the form during your company's open enrollment period or upon initial employment. Check with your HR for specific deadlines.
What methods are available for submitting the completed form?
You can submit the completed form by downloading it and emailing it to your payroll representative, or by directly submitting through online payroll platforms, if available.
What supporting documents do I need to submit with this form?
Typically, no additional documents are required with the HSA Payroll Deduction Form. However, verify with your HR department for any specific requirements.
What common mistakes should I avoid while filling out this form?
Make sure all personal details are accurate, and avoid omitting your signature. Review all entries for clarity and correctness before submission.
How long does it take to process the HSA Payroll Deduction Form?
Processing time may vary, but generally it can take one full payroll cycle to see changes reflected in your deductions. Consult your HR for more precise timing.
Are there any fees associated with processing this form?
There are typically no fees specifically associated with submitting the HSA Payroll Deduction Form, but check with your employer for any related costs.
